Annie Cargill Knight (nee Murray; 10 April 1906 - 4 November 1996) was a Scottish nurse in the Spanish Civil War (1936-1939). Knight was the daughter of a tenant farmer and one of eight children. She became active in the Communist Party after she finished her training as a nurse. She was one of the first British volunteers to arrive in Spain on the side of the Spanish Republican Government during the Spanish Civil War.
